Sunil Mittal, others back Tatas  

New Delhi/Chennai August 30:
The Tata Group's small car project at Singur in West Bengal is drawing more support from top industrialists across the country, after the car maker threatened to pull out of the state citing security concerns.
 
Silver plunges on lack of support, gold remains firm 

New Delhi, Aug 30:
Silver prices plunged on Saturday by Rs 240 at Rs 20,660 per kg on the bullion market on reduced offtake by industrial units, while gold maintained upward march on sustained buying by jewellers.
 
Stocks end lower on personal income data 

New York, Aug 30:
Wall Street tumbled on Friday after the government said personal incomes fell last month by the largest amount in nearly three years while consumer spending slowed.
